R Class System Installation
1. Install the Rack Kit and Server Into the Cabinet
1A. Install the Rack Kit
1. Decide where in the cabinet the new computer equipment is to be installed. R
Class servers should be installed in the cabinet's topmost available 6 EIA units On
C2785A, C2786A, and C2787A cabinets, each EIA unit is marked by a triangular
hole. On the J1501A, J1502A, and J1503A cabinets, these units are numbered.
2. Locate the rectangular mounting holes on the rack columns for the support rail
(every fifth mounting hole is notched).
3. Position the four M5 sheet metal nuts over the top round holes adjacent to the
rectangular mounting holes.
4. If you have an A4900A, A4901A, or A4902A cabinet, install one spacer into each
column, so the sheet metal nut is directly behind the top hole in the spacer. See the
included spacer installation guide (J1516-90001) for detailed instructions.
5. Slip the rail flanges into the rectangular mounting holes of the column (or spacer).
The rails should stay in place. The example below shows the rail flange inserted in
the spacer.
